I applied through a recruiter. The process took 6 weeks. I interviewed at QA Consulting (Manchester, England) in Feb 2020
Interview
QA recruitment process was very friendly, but also many check-in calls before the process to talk through it.
Assessment day:
>Icebreakers
>Presentation by BAE Systems (intended role)
>10 min personality/aptitude test
>3 group activities - groups are 6ish people, and during the activities, they pull 1 person per group for a 1:1 interview.
Interview: Standard competency-based. Be prepared for the interviewer to have not looked at your CV until that morning. Also timed! About 20 mins? But depending on the interviewer, they won't cut you off immediately, more of a 'soft warning' so the day ends on time.
Other notes:
Can be a long day! 10 am - 4.45 pm
Didn't get the BAE job, but QA is also there to assess you and they offer a Digital Consultant programme.
I applied online.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at QA Consulting (Manchester, England) in Mar 2019
Interview
Went there. Had ice breaker about knowing the company. Then python refresher, python exam, then 3 group exercise which had 1 presentation.
1 of the exercise to test your reasoning and risk. Second problem solving and third to check your presentation skill.
